PURPOSE OF THE POSITION:
To fill all salami products in their relevant casings and hang or pack products according to product specifications as per production plan.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ATION & E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ENT:
- Grade 12
- 1 year experience in a similar position
- Knowledge of processed meat processes
KEY JOB OUTPUTS:
- Machines, packaging material, and casings prepared, set up, and ready according to the daily production plan and supplier specifications
- Production equipment functioning correctly, with scales, chillers, and machines checked, maintained, and faults reported promptly
- Meat and meat products prepared accurately and on time to support uninterrupted production
- Products filled, hung, packed, and transferred to climate chambers according to production and quality requirements
- Correct product weight, sealing quality, expiry dates, and packaging integrity consistently achieved and verified
- Product samples taken during start-up, production, and post-production to confirm compliance with filling and quality standards
- Batches correctly tagged and traceable in line with the production plan
- Daily production records completed accurately and timeously
- Stock items moved, counted, and supported effectively during stock-taking activities
- Quality defects, damages, or deviations identified early and reported to the supervisor for corrective action
- Casings inspected and weight measurements performed to ensure compliance with prescribed specifications
- Full compliance with company quality standards, food safety requirements, and cold chain regulations
- Work areas, machines, and equipment kept clean, sanitised, and hygienic at all times following clean-as-you-go principles
- Health, safety, hygiene, and GMP requirements consistently adhered to, including correct PPE usage
- Machinery cleaned, sanitised, shut down correctly, and stored safely at the end of production
- Support provided across departments and tasks as required to ensure smooth production operations
